More About "crossword clue depressed"
The clue "depressed" is a classic in the world of crosswords, often appearing in various forms across different puzzle types. Its versatility stems from the word's multiple meanings: it can refer to a state of mind (feeling low or sad), a physical characteristic (a sunken or pressed-down surface), or even a geographical feature (a depressed area, like a basin). This semantic breadth allows setters to use it in creative ways, making it essential for solvers to consider the broader context of the puzzle.
When you encounter "depressed" in a crossword, don't just think of emotions. Consider if the answer might relate to an object that is pressed down, a landscape that is lower than its surroundings, or even a market that is in decline. Checking the number of letters and any intersecting words will quickly help you narrow down the possibilities and pinpoint the exact solution the setter had in mind.
Tips For Your Next Puzzle
- Context is Key: Always look at the surrounding clues and the overall theme of the crossword. Is it a general knowledge puzzle, or does it have a specific theme that might influence the meaning of "depressed"?
- Check Letter Count First: Before anything else, match the length of your blank spaces to the potential answers. This immediately eliminates many possibilities.
- Cross-Reference: Use intersecting words to confirm your choices. If you're unsure between "SAD" and "LOW" for a 3-letter answer, see which one fits with the crossing clues.
- Think Synonyms & Antonyms: For emotional clues like "depressed", consider a wide range of synonyms. Sometimes, the clue might even be an antonym to lead you to an unexpected answer.
- Consider Alternative Meanings: As discussed for "depressed," words often have multiple meanings. Don't get stuck on the most obvious interpretation.
